Transaction 8c879d7639faeba104c8a81e3ddeb5dd7f9395f2368d360ca35d33b0eb92a6a1

block
bbd3b2266a47cc8f0380c009e40b8eb99bd09a123a0a1ee5b3d37e44536871c9

1 Input

25 Outputs